相关文章
【机器学习】近似分布的熵到底是p(x)lnq(x)还是q(x)lnq(x)?
【1】通信的定义
信息量(Information Content)是信息论中的一个核心概念,用于定量描述一个事件发生时所提供的“信息”的多少。它通常用随机变量 𝑥的概率分布来定义。事件 𝑥发生所携带的信息量由公式给出࿱…
建站知识
2024/11/25 15:58:26
python学习笔记(8)算法(1)数组
一、数组
数组是存储于一个连续空间且具有相同数据类型的元素集合。若将有限个类型相同的变量的集合命名,那么这个名称为数组名。组成数组的各个变量称为数组的分量,也称为数组的元素,有时也称为下标变量。用于区分数组的各个元素的数字编号…
建站知识
2024/11/25 15:57:24
C++(进阶) 第1章 继承
C(进阶) 第1章 继承 文章目录 前言一、继承1.什么是继承2.继承的使用 二、继承方式1.private成员变量的(3种继承方式)继承2. private继承方式3.继承基类成员访问⽅式的变化 三、基类和派生类间的转换1.切片 四、 继承中的作⽤域1.隐藏规则&am…
建站知识
2024/11/25 15:56:22
第 26 章 -Golang 第三方库的使用
在 Go 语言中,第三方库的使用是开发过程中非常常见且重要的一部分。合理地选择和使用第三方库可以极大地提高开发效率,减少重复造轮子的时间。以下是关于如何查找、选择、安装和使用第三方库,以及维护方面的建议。
如何查找和选择第三方库
…
建站知识
2024/11/25 15:55:21
【大数据技术基础】 课程 第5章 HBase的安装和基础编程 大数据基础编程、实验和案例教程(第2版)
第5章 HBase的安装和基础编程
5.1 安装HBase
5.1.1 下载安装文件
访问HBase官网下载安装文件hbase-2.2.2-bin.tar.gz文件。
下载完安装文件以后,需要对文件进行解压。按照Linux系统使用的默认规范,用户安装的软件一般都是存放在“/usr/local/”目录下…
建站知识
2024/11/25 15:54:19
SpringBoot 集成 html2Pdf
一、概述: 1. springboot如何生成pdf,接口可以预览可以下载 2. vue下载通过bold如何下载 3. 一些细节:页脚、页眉、水印、每一页得样式添加
二、直接上代码【主要是一个记录下次开发更快】
模板位置 1. 导入pom包
<dependency><g…
建站知识
2024/11/25 15:53:17
40分钟学 Go 语言高并发实战:高性能缓存组件开发
高性能缓存组件开发
学习要点:
缓存淘汰策略并发安全设计性能优化监控统计
一、缓存淘汰策略
缓存作为性能优化的常用手段,如何选择合适的缓存淘汰策略是关键。常见的缓存淘汰策略有以下几种:
策略特点FIFO (First In First Out)先进先出,淘汰最早添加的缓存项LRU (Least …
建站知识
2024/11/25 15:51:10